Title:
METHOD FOR PRODUCING MESO-ZEAXANTHINE
Document Type and Number:
Japanese Patent JP3782051
Kind Code:
B2
Abstract:

PROBLEM TO BE SOLVED: To provide a method for efficiently producing a meso-zeaxanthine in a high yield.
SOLUTION: This method for producing the three-dimensionally homogeneous meso-zeaxanthine comprises (a) resolving a racemic mixture of acetylenediols (R-I) and (S-I) to enantiomers (R-I) and (S-I), (b) each converting the enantiomers (R-I) and (S-I) to 15C phosphonium salts (R-II) and (S-II), (c) reacting R-II or S-II with a 10C dialkylmonoacetal by Wittig reaction to provide 25C acetal R-IV or S-IV, (d) converting R-IV or S-IV to 25C aldehyde R-V or S-V and (e) reacting R-V with a 15C phosphonium salt S-II or reacting S-V with a 15C phosphonium salt R-II.
